    2-Hydroxyphenylacetic acid is a metabolite of Phenylalanine and Tyrosine, as well as a product of the biotransformation of Phenylacetonitrile by marine fungi. 2-Hydroxyphenylacetic acid acts as a potential biomarker for food. 2-Hydroxyphenylacetic acid slightly induces the expression of green fluorescent protein. 2-Hydroxyphenylacetic acid is used in the research of phenylketonuria and related hyperphenylalaninemia .

    6-Dehydroprogesterone (Δ6-Progesterone) is a steroid compound that can be found in Botryodiplodia theobromae. 6-Dehydroprogesterone is a metabolic product of Progesterone (HY-N0437) after a microbial dehydrogenation reaction. 6-Dehydroprogesterone can be used to study steroid metabolism pathways, microbial dehydrogenase activity, and the biotransformation of steroids .

    4'-Demethylpodophyllotoxone is an intermediate product of the biotransformation of Alternaria alternata S-f6. After 4'-Demethylpodophyllotoxone is modified with 4-(2,3,5,6-tetramethylpyrazine-1) (4-TMP), the resulting novel compound can strongly inhibit the growth of human gastric cancer cell line (BGC-823) .

    Dihydrodaidzin is an isoflavanone that can be isolated from Soybeans. Dihydrodaidzin is also a product of biotransformation by human intestinal bacteria .

Nebicapone (BIA 3-202), a reversible catechol-O-methyltransferase (COMT) inhibitor, is mainly metabolized by glucuronidation. Nebicapone is mainly peripherally acting inhibitor that decreases the biotransformation of L-DOPA to 3-O-methyl-DOPA by inhibition of COMT, and it is potential for the treatment of Parkinson's disease .

    Indole-3-thio carboxamide is an antifungal agent. Indole-3-thio carboxamide is a biotransformation product of Camalexin (HY-119502) by plant pathogenic fungi Botrytis cinerea .

    Neomethymycin (Compound5) is a 12-membered ring macrolide natural product. Neomethymycin can be found in engineered Streptomyces venezuelae ATCC 15439 strain DHS2001, where it forms via biotransformation of 10-deoxymethyonolide .

    cis-Oxyresveratrol-4'-O-glucoside (compound 2a) is a β-D-glucoside derivative of oxyresveratrol, whose parent compound possesses potential an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, free radical scavenging, and tyrosinase inhibitory activities, and can be used in an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, and whitening-related research. cis-Oxyresveratrol-4'-O-glucoside is a product obtained by the biotransformation of oxyresveratrol using cell suspension cultures of Solanum mammosum (a plant of the genus Solanum in the Solanaceae family) .

    3-Heptanol is a biotransformation product of n-heptane. 3-Heptanol can act as the building block in the synthesis of 4-(3-adamantan-1-yl-ureido)-butyric acid and cyclohexanecarboxylic acid derivatives as sEH inhibitors. 3-Heptanol can be used as a solvent to form microenvironments around single-walled carbon nanotubes. 3-Heptanol can be used in the preperation of substituted pyrimidine derivatives as C1 domain-targeted isophthalate analogs to study their binding affinities towards PKCα isoform .
